传统体重秤只有一个数据的显示功能,将需称重物体放置在体脂秤上,体重秤显示当前物体的数据,物体移开,数据消失,体重秤没有数据记录、存储、分析功能。智能体脂秤与传统体重秤相比,可通过低功耗蓝牙与手机APP连接,将体脂秤上获得的数据传输到APP,通过APP可实现对当前称重物体数据的接收,如果对同一称重物体在不同时间段称重,累计的称重数据可存储在系统后台,在积累的数据基础上实现对称重物体体重变化的数据分析。由于采用低功耗蓝牙传输数据,智能体脂秤具有体积小、功耗低等特点,体现为体脂秤的便携式和智能化。
本设计以CSU18M92单片机为主控芯片制作了一款蓝牙数字电子秤,以电阻应变式压力传感器来进行称重,将感应到的被测物体的重力转化为微弱的毫伏级电压信号,通过芯片内部增益放大,将此放大的模拟电压信号经过AD转换电路转化为数字信号通过引脚单片机普通数字IO口进行处理,即将二进制信号转换成十进制,同时将测量物体的重量显示在LCD显示屏上,同时通过蓝牙模块将数据传输到手机上。
它最基本的功能是蓝牙体脂秤方案:
1、测体重:站起来1~3秒钟后,秤能很准确地显示体重;
2、测体脂率:光脚站在秤上,可以通过双脚分析体内脂肪比,秤会自动存储记录信息,快速分析BMI(身体质量指数);
3、无线连接手机APP:将体重和身体质量指数同步到APP/云数据库等;此外,还可以打开闹钟功能,秤会自动提醒称重,完成重量后,闹钟会自动停止。
蓝牙体脂秤方案用到的主控芯片CSU18M92
CSU18M92是一款支持4电极交流测脂、高精度人体称重的SOC芯片。芯片包含人体阻抗测量模块BIM、24bit Sigma-Delta ADC、8K×16位MTP程序存储器、128字节EEPROM和896字节数据存储器。
高性能的RISC CPU:
8位单片机MCU
内置8K×16位一次性可编程存储器(MTP ROM)和128Bytes EEPROM
896字节数据存储器(SRAM)
只有46条单字指令
8级存储堆栈
模拟特性:
1路输入全差分24Bit Sigma-Delta型ADC,1/64/128倍增益选择。
6路外部通道和2路内部通道的10Bit SAR ADC
4电极交流人体阻抗测量(BIM)模块
ADC的输出速率15.2Hz~3.9KHz
内带电荷泵
内带稳压器供传感器和调制器
内部集成的可编程增益放大器
专用微控制器的特性:
上电复位(POR)
上电复位延迟定时器(39ms)
内带低电压复位(LVR)
定时器0
-可编程预分频的8位的定时器
定时/计数器123
-可编程预分频的8位的定时/计数器
外设特性:
31位双向I/O口,其中部分PT2.1~PT2.4、PT3*、PT4*复用作LCD/LED口
13个具有唤醒功能的输入口
2路UART,波特率最高支持115200bps
1路I2C从机,支持标准模式(100K bit/s)和快速模式(400K bit/s)
1路SPI,最高通信速率500KHz
1路蜂鸣器输出,电流能力6mA
支持6*22的LCD驱动或4*14 LED驱动
低电压比较功能(LVD),可用做电源电压比较和外部电压比较
内置温度传感器
具有RTC功能,年、月、日、星期、小时、分、秒信息